NEW DELHI, SEPT 9: Mahanagar Telephone Nigam Ltd8217;s MTNL proposed disinvestment of 19 million government shares would hit the market by the end of October, a top company official said here today.

quot;We are expecting to hit the overseas market for the global depository receipt GDR issue by the end of next monthquot;, MTNL chairman and managing director S Rajagopalan told newspersons.

He, however, said that no final decision has been taken on whether to divest part of the equity in the domestic market along with the GDR issue.

Regarding appointment of global coordinators, Rajagopalan said it was likely that the same coordinators who were earlier given the responsibility of MTNL8217;s GDR issue in 1997 Goldman Sach, Hong Kong and Shanghai Banking Corporation HSBC and Merill Lynch would be appointed.

Cabinet had decided to divest up to 19 million shares in MTNL through an institutional offering in GDR or in the domestic market with an expected revenue in the range of Rs 400 crore.
